The planet known for having large amounts of iron oxide in its soil and polar ice caps is Mars. It is known to be the second smallest planet in the solar system. It is also known as the Red Planet due to the reddish appearance of the soil which is caused by the high amounts of iron.

The planet known for being covered in cliffs and craters and having a weak magnetic field is Mercury. It is the closest to the sun and the smallest planet in the solar system.

Comets are hypothesized to come from the Oort Cloud which is located beyond the orbit of the planets.

D. Climate: One of the significant reasons to consider San Francisco and Los Angeles as located in separate regions is their distinct climates. San Francisco has a cool-summer Mediterranean climate characterized by mild, wet winters and dry summers with temperatures moderated by the Pacific Ocean. In contrast, Los Angeles has a Mediterranean climate with hot, dry summers and mild, wet winters. The climate difference between the two cities contributes to variations in vegetation, agriculture, and overall lifestyle.

The other options, A, B, and C, are not strong reasons for considering them as separate regions:

A. Language: Language is not a distinguishing factor between San Francisco and Los Angeles as both cities predominantly use English as the primary language.

B. National boundaries: Both San Francisco and Los Angeles are located within the United States, so national boundaries do not separate them.

C. Radio and television station markets: While there may be some differences in media markets, they do not necessarily define separate regions, especially considering that media markets can overlap or change over time.
